Join David Gascoigne from Waterloo Region Nature as he leads the group on a fall bird walk along the trails at RIM Park. Enjoy the fall colours and take the opportunity to learn and observe the birds native to our area. Bring your own binoculars for an optimal experience or request a pair to borrow.The meeting point for this walk will be at the Eastside Branch (attached to RIM park). Please arrive early as we will departing onto the trail at 2pm.
Presented in partnership with Waterloo Region Nature.
This is a drop-in programs for adults.
